safely transport passengers per set schedule;
supervise passengers and ensure bus safety rules are regarded;
assist in emergency situations and administer basic first aid;
carry out regulated safety inspections and complete logs;
report bus deficiencies and malfunctions to the mechanic;
clean bus as scheduled and/or required;
participate in job-related training and staff development;
communicate positively and effectively, and interact as a collaborative and consultative team member;
understand and act in accordance with school and district policies and procedures, district Health & Safety Manual, WorkSafeBC regulations, Motor Vehicle Act, and National Safety Code;
maintain confidentiality; and
other duties as assigned.

Class 2 BC driver's licence with air endorsement;
one year experience in bus passenger transportation obtained within the last three years, and a safe driving record (driver abstract required);
thorough understanding of the Motor Vehicle Act and National Safety Code;
demonstrated ability to drive a school bus;
ability to take direction from the supervisor and work as part of a team;
effective communication skills in verbal, written and electronic format;
strong problem-solving and organizational skills; and
physical ability to perform all aspects of the position.
Note: Clear criminal record checks are required prior to employment with the district.
